"Hide and Seek"
Ship: USS Agincourt
Class: Constitution
The Federation suspects that the Klingon Governor Dumas, who led an attack on Pascal II with Klingon and Romulan warships, is a renegade acting without the authority of the empire. In addition, one of the Romulan Warbirds involved in the battle at Pascal II attacked two Federation ships, the USS Demeter and the USS Alexandria. The Demeter was destroyed, but the Romulan ship's warp engines were damaged. In this scenario, you join the Alexandria and the USS Rutherford in a mission to find the crippled Romulan ship.
You'll be involved in some heavy combat, so before warping to Pascal II set your damage-control teams to ensure the integrity of all systems related to combat - shields, phasers, photons, hull, and warp. Go to red alert and increase energy allocation for photons and phasers as much as you can while still maintaining at least normal shield levels, then switch back to green alert so you can enter warp.
Warp to Pascal: Forester will automatically follow Sturek's advice for locating the Romulan ship. When Sturek suggests localizing the search, enter warp. You'll arrive near a planet with the remains of the Demeter almost directly in front of you. Go to red alert and blast the Demeter into nothingness - that way it won't clutter your radar when you're in battle. Then turn right so that the planet is in the center of your view screen.
Find the Romulan: The Romulan ship will uncloak on the left side of the planet. Immediately target his warp drive and open fire with everything you've got as soon as he does - if he escapes the mission's a failure. Pursue and destroy him to the exclusion of all else; two Klingon warships will show up as you chase the Warbird, but the Rutherford and Alexandria should delay them long enough to give you a chance to finish the Romulan. Once the Romulan is destroyed, assist the Alexandria and Rutherford in their fight against the Klingon ships. When they've been reduced to space dust, head back to Starbase.
